2. Mastering the Answer-Writing Craft
Sociology is a subjective paper, and the examiner is looking for a "sociological imagination." This means your answer should show an objective analysis rather than a personal opinion. Under the guidance of the Best Sociology Optional Teacher, you will learn to structure your essays to provide a balanced view, citing various sociologists to support your arguments.
